I need help. A few days ago my wife drove up to the house, turned off the engine and opened the gate - C3 has not wanted to start the engine since then.
After connecting the computer, the following errors appeared: P0409, P1351, P1162 and P0489.
Since then I have done: cleaned the FAP filter, replaced the FAP pressure sensor, cleaned the EGR valve and replaced the fuel filter - the engine still does not want to start.
Please help me what else should I check and replace to get the engine to work.

You could check the camshaft sensor (on backside behind the inlet side of the manifold, it was hard to get to on mine I had to remove wipers ans scuttles), crankshaft sensor (beside crank pulley, see image), I inspected my fuel rail sensor as well because I had the gearbox removed and thought it might be damaged. So far none of these seem to be the cause of my problem, I am messing with the EGR now since it is a pretty crappy knock off.

You need to look at the live data when cranking, have you got fuel pressure, does cam/crank synch change to yes, and can you see engine rpm (about 180 cranking)? Sudden stop on these is often due to the cambelt breaking....
